Web9 de mai. de 2014 · The American linguist Christopher Ehret says. Africa south of the Sahara, it now seems, was home to a separate and independent invention of iron metallurgy …. To sum up the available evidence, iron technology across much of sub-Saharan Africa has an African origin dating to before 1000 BCE. Until the 1950s, European scientists believed that Homo sapiens evolved in Europe, or possibly in Asia, about 60,000 years ago.
